The Merit-based Incentive Payment System (MIPS) scores providers 0–100 across four performance categories: Quality, Cost, Promoting Interoperability, and Improvement Activities, weighted under 42 CFR §414.1380. Reporting is voluntary for many small practices, so absence of a MIPS score is not a quality signal.

STEPHEN MATLOCK appears in the CMS NPPES registry as a MOHS-Micrographic Surgery Physician provider at 7901 W 135TH ST, OVERLAND PARK, KS, 66223, with a listed phone of (913) 451-7546. NPI 1811494727 was issued on 04/07/2018. Because NPPES data is self-reported by the provider and refreshed monthly, the address, phone, and specialty reflect what MATLOCK most recently submitted to CMS rather than a vetted directory listing, which is why patients should always confirm the practice is still at this location before scheduling.
Medicare Part D records for calendar year 2023 show 748 prescription claims written by this provider, covering 401 Medicare beneficiaries and totaling roughly $38K in drug spend, split 2% brand-name and 98% generic by claim count. These figures capture only Medicare Part D — commercial insurance, Medicaid, and cash-pay prescriptions are not included, and any drug-beneficiary cell under 11 is suppressed by CMS for patient privacy. On the CMS Merit-based Incentive Payment System, this provider earned a Final Score of 77.9/100 for the 2023 performance year, compared with the national average of 83.1.
MOHS-Micrographic Surgery Physician is a narrow specialty nationwide, with 1,102 enrolled providers across 52 states and an average of 607 Part D claims per prescriber, so the context for interpreting these metrics differs meaningfully from a primary-care baseline. The federal Physician Payments Sunshine Act (part of the Affordable Care Act) requires drug and medical-device manufacturers + group purchasing organizations to publicly report payments and other transfers of value to physicians and teaching hospitals. Industry payments are not necessarily indicators of bias — they include research funding, consulting fees for evidence-based work, royalties for inventions, food at conferences, and similar items. The disclosure exists for transparency. Read our methodology for how we interpret this data.
